Kemal Yaylali e76ae847a1 fix(science): stop scoring evidence that was never looked up
A review of the ranking's arithmetic found four things wrong, all of which
made the score look better informed than it was. Measurements below are from
this repo, not estimates.

**Components now abstain instead of inventing a number.** A run without a VEP
cache returns no allele frequencies, and rarity_score(None) read that as
"absent from gnomAD, therefore maximally rare" and awarded every variant a
free 0.25. jobs.has_frequencies / has_effect_scores record what the run
actually produced, absent components are dropped from the weighted mean, and
the remaining weights are renormalised so the score keeps its meaning. The UI
shows "not looked up" rather than a bar, and the funnel stops calling a step
"rare" when nothing was filtered.

**Allele frequency is no longer a model feature.** It dominated: the same
missense variant scored 0.887 at AF 0 and 0.0003 at AF 0.01. That double-
counted, because the ranking already scores frequency explicitly, putting
~45% of every rank on one measurement; and it was circular, because ACMG
assigns ClinVar's benign labels using frequency (BA1/BS1). Retraining without
it moves missense AUROC from 0.872 to 0.500 — exactly random. The old figure
was allele frequency, not variant-effect knowledge. The model therefore
abstains unless CADD or AlphaMissense is present, since otherwise it only
restates the consequence class.

**Phenotype matching is weighted by information content** and HPO annotations
are propagated up the ontology. Counting terms alike let "global
developmental delay" (IC 0.93) count as much as "dilated left subclavian
artery" (IC 7.88).

**A real bug in the propagation, found by checking it.** The ancestor walk
read a pre-order DFS backwards, which on a DAG lets a term resolve before one
of its parents and inherit that parent alone instead of its lineage. It
dropped 399 terms out of the phenotype branch, Camptodactyly and Chiari
malformation among them. Now a true post-order, tested against a reference
transitive closure.

The ontology arithmetic moved to rarelens_ml.hpo so it is covered by tests,
and rarelens_ml.benchmark measures the whole thing: across 10,178 published
cases the causal gene ranks first 45.9-81.0% of the time against 5,269 genes,
versus 0.02% for chance. docs/data.md reports that with its contamination
(HPO's annotations come from these same case reports), and includes the
measurement showing information-content weighting earns its place while
propagation does not - kept anyway, for a reason the docs argue rather than
assume.

"""Loader tests. DB tests use DATABASE_URL (CI's Postgres service) or a throwaway pgserver."""
import os
import sys
import tempfile
from collections.abc import Iterator
from pathlib import Path
import pytest
sys.path.insert(0, str(Path(__file__).resolve().parents[1] / "bin"))
# The subset of the Alembic schema (api/alembic/versions) that the loader writes to.
SCHEMA = """
CREATE TYPE jobstatus AS ENUM ('queued', 'running', 'succeeded', 'failed');
CREATE TABLE jobs (
id uuid PRIMARY KEY,
status jobstatus NOT NULL,
vep_version text,
has_frequencies boolean NOT NULL DEFAULT false,
has_effect_scores boolean NOT NULL DEFAULT false,
log text,
finished_at timestamptz
);
CREATE TABLE variants (
id serial PRIMARY KEY,
job_id uuid NOT NULL,
chrom text NOT NULL, pos integer NOT NULL, ref text NOT NULL, alt text NOT NULL,
gene text, consequence text, impact text, hgvsc text, hgvsp text,
gnomad_af double precision, clinvar_sig text, annotations jsonb NOT NULL
);
"""
_server = None
def _url() -> str | None:
global _server
if url := os.environ.get("DATABASE_URL"):
return url
try:
import pgserver
except ImportError:
return None
_server = pgserver.get_server(tempfile.mkdtemp(prefix="loader-pg-"), cleanup_mode="delete")
return "postgresql://postgres@/postgres?host=" + _server.get_uri().split("host=", 1)[1]
@pytest.fixture
def engine() -> Iterator:
url = _url()
if not url:
if os.environ.get("REQUIRE_DB"):
pytest.fail("REQUIRE_DB is set but no database is available")
pytest.skip("no DATABASE_URL and pgserver is not installed")
from load_db import engine_for
eng = engine_for(url)
with eng.begin() as conn:
conn.exec_driver_sql("DROP TABLE IF EXISTS variants, jobs; DROP TYPE IF EXISTS jobstatus")
conn.exec_driver_sql(SCHEMA)
yield eng
eng.dispose()
